Real Housewives Jo De La Rosa Wants To Set The Record Straight on Slade
By Marilyn Beck and Stacy Jenel SmithJun 16, 2008
from: National Ledger
If there's one thing Jo De La Rosa of Bravo's "The Real Housewives of Orange County" wants to make known, it's that former fiance Slade Smiley is not her manager, as has been reported. "He's not anything to do with business. I don't know why people thought he was my manager, but he's not," she tells us. "If anything, Slade's been my guide for the last couple of years," she adds. "If I had any question on contracts or decisions I've had to make, I would go to him. He's also been there if I ever needed a little push or whenever I had some self-doubt."
The status of the two will certainly become clear when her "Date My Ex" reality show premieres on Bravo July 21. Besides serving as her supportive friend as she works on recording an album, he'll be seen acting as her guide in a much more personal sense as he sizes up her prospective boyfriends.
De La Rosa acknowledges that their relationship continues to be a big topic for most fans. "I went through a lot of hard stuff with Slade on the 'Housewives' show. We broke off our engagement on that show, which was hard to do in front of America. Every day I feel like I have someone coming up to me telling me what I should have done or not to be so hard on Slade. They're either Team Jo or Team Slade."
